    Consequences of non-observance of procedural due process on employee termination



    Dear PAO,

    I own a small laundry shop here in the Metro. I only have two employees—one of whom I had to let go last month because of her excessive absences. For context, for the month of January of this year alone, said employee had already incurred 12 absences. This ongoing pattern of unauthorized absenteeism has been disrupting the operation of my business. I decided to send her a text message informing her of her immediate termination from employment, which I now realize is an improper way of dismissing an employee. I just want to know my liabilities as an employer who failed to comply with the proper way of dismissing an employee. Thank you.
